Rightmove says that its newly rebranded Landlord & Tenant Services has made improvements to the time it takes for an agent to request and receive a reference, with the average time now 20% quicker than last year.

As well as quicker referencing times, the property website argues that letting agents are now benefitting from a redesigned referencing platform that launched last week, allowing them to book a reference in just one click. All of these developments are part of Rightmove’s new Rent in Five plan.
